UNIT PRESENTATION
Following process
1 pts
Needs development
2 pts
Consistently used
3 pts
Proficiently used
4 pts
Mastery
5 pts
Clarity
Following process
Doesn't speak clearly and distinctly (20-0%), doesn't use complete sentences and mispronounces a lot of words.
Needs development
Doesn't speak clearly and distinctly almost all (40-20%) the time, doesn't use complete sentences and mispronounces a many words.
Consistently used
Speaks clearly and distinctly some (60-40%) of the time, but sometimes uses complete sentences and mispronounces several words.
Proficiently used
Speaks clearly and distinctly most (80-60%) the time, usually uses complete sentences, but mispronounces a few words.
Mastery
Speaks clearly and distinctly all (100-80%) the time, uses complete sentences, and mispronounces no words.
Group management
Following process
The student(s) did not control students' discipline nor Spanish
Needs development
The student(s) tried a few times to control students' discipline and Spanish
Consistently used
The student(s) sometimes handled discipline and controlled Spanish.
Proficiently used
Students generally handled well discipline and controlled Spanish.
Mastery
The student(s) handled very well discipline and controlled Spanish.
Topic command
Following process
The student(s) couldn't manage the topic and was(were) relying all the time on the book/notes.
Needs development
The student(s) couldn't manage the topic and was(were) relying too much on the book/notes.
Consistently used
The student(s) could sometimes manage the topic making fair use of the book/notes.
Proficiently used
The student(s) could manage the topic looking at the book/notes a few times.
Mastery
The student(s) could easily and correctly manage the topic without looking at the book/notes.
GRAMMAR EXERCISE
Following process
The grammar exercise was not previously thought for the practice of the topic / The student(s) didn't bring any materials for his/her classmates.
Needs development
The grammar exercise was practically not thought for the practice of the topic / The student(s) brings very few materials for his/her classmates.
Consistently used
The grammar exercise was somewhat thought for the practice of the topic / The student(s) brings some materials for his/her classmates.
Proficiently used
The grammar exercise was basically thought for the practice of the topic / The student(s) brings a good amount of materials for his/her classmates.
Mastery
The grammar exercise was previously thought for the practice of the topic / The student(s) brings enough materials for his/her classmates.
